Influencer Kubra Aykut, a 26-year-old Turkish woman who went viral with her “Wedding without a Groom” videos on TikTok, took her own life in Istanbul. Aykut reportedly fell from a five-story luxury apartment building in Sultanbeyli district, according to reports from Turkish media.
Investigators found a suicide note at the scene of the September 23 incident.
Many fans expressed worry about Kubra’s increasingly troubling social media posts in the days before she committed suicide. She wrote a heartfelt letter on her account a few hours before she passed away, talking about her struggles with weight gain.
“I feel like I’ve got my energy back, but I’m not gaining weight. I shed a kilo each day. She wrote in her most recent post, “I need to gain weight badly, but I don’t know what to do.”
Shortly before she committed suicide, Kubra was spotted tidying her home in her most recent TikTok video.
Aykut was particularly well-known for having two million Instagram followers and one million TikTok followers.
2023 saw Kubra become extremely well-known on TikTok thanks to her inspirational and one-of-a-kind “Wedding without a Groom” series. She made a startling gesture when she declared, “I can’t find a worthy groom for myself,” while dressing elegantly in white and sporting a tiara.
Another video shows Kubra happily cheering as she drives off in a car with a bouquet in her hand. She made fun of herself by eating a burger in a different viral video while still wearing her wedding gown and referred to herself as a “nervous bride.”
The circumstances surrounding Aykut’s death are being investigated by Turkish authorities, and a post-mortem examination of her body is currently being conducted.
